Hinges for GWS A-10
A friend of mine recently gave me a GWS A-10 kit that he had lying around. I have put it together but it was missing the pack of hinges for the ailerons and elevators. I was wondering was I could use to replace them. I have been flying RC helis for awhile but I have never built or flown an airplane so I am unfamiliar with the materials involved. I have tried to find a clear picture of what they look like with no luck. The manual was also missing from the kit and the one from the GWS website is very low quality. I assume they are standard hinges such as these: http://www.allerc.com/product_info.php?products_id=194 Any help would be appreciated.

RE: Hinges for GWS A-10
I had one of those a while back. The hinges did not come packaged. They were a rectangular piece of some kind of cheap CA hinge but looked more like a piece of paper in the bottom of the box. Cut them to size and use the like regular ca hinges.
